IN THE COUNTY LEGISLATURE OF JACKSON COUNTY, MISSOURI

A RESOLUTION congratulating Elle Moxley on her recent designation as a National Merit Scholarship finalist.

RESOLUTION # 15898, May 22, 2006

INTRODUCED BY Bob Spence, County Legislator


WHEREAS, Elle Moxley, daughter of Debra and Chip Moxley, is a senior at Lee's Summit North High School and has earned the designation of finalist in the National Merit Scholarship program; and,

WHEREAS, the National Merit Scholarship Corporation, founded in 1955, conducts an annual National Merit Scholarship competition by administering the Preliminary SAT/National Merit Scholarship Qualifying Test, which produces a nationwide pool of semi-finalists representing less than one percent of U.S. high school seniors and includes the highest scoring entrants in each state; and,

WHEREAS, National Merit Scholarship finalists will be eligible for National Merit Scholarship awards; and,

WHEREAS, through her pursuit of academic excellence, Elle has earned the designation of National Merit Scholarship finalist; and,

WHEREAS, Elle is an active student at Lee's Summit North High School where she is editor of the Northern Exposure newspaper, assistant editor of the Aurora yearbook, National Honor Society member, and a member of Youth in Government; and,

WHEREAS, she has earned numerous awards and honors including Northern Exposure's Best Entertainment Article, Outstanding Writer of the Year, Best News Article, Best In-Depth Article, and Journalist of the Year, Missouri Youth in Government's Outstanding Press Editor and Outstanding Associate Editor, and Excellent and Superior ratings at the Missouri Interscholastic Press Association Journalism day; and,

WHEREAS, in addition to her academic achievements, Elle is an active community member who has volunteered her time working concessions at community swim meets, assisting with Oktoberfest, and teaching French to Underwood fifth graders; and,
